u00a0Just a short while ago, India was riding high on a wave of success, defeating arch-rivals Pakistan in a closely contested series. Their batting prowess was on full display as they piled on the runs and secured victory. Expectations were soaring, and optimism ran high among Indian cricket enthusiasts.
    However, their confidence was shattered when they faced Sri Lanka. In a shocking turn of events, India struggled to put runs on the board, recording their lowest batting total in recent memory. The collapse was so dramatic that even the staunchest supporters were left in disbelief.
    Several factors contributed to India’s batting woes. The Sri Lankan bowlers exploited the conditions effectively, extracting movement from the pitch and troubling the Indian batsmen with swing and seam. The top-order, which had been so reliable against Pakistan, failed to provide a strong foundation.

    Additionally, poor shot selection and a lack of patience in the middle-order further compounded India’s problems. Batsmen who had been in sublime form during the Pakistan series suddenly looked out of touch. It was a collective failure, and the team struggled to cross the 100-run mark in both innings.

    The contrast between the Pakistan series and the Sri Lanka series couldn’t have been starker. The rapid transition from highs to lows left fans in a state of shock and disappointment. Questions were raised about the team’s ability to adapt to different conditions and opponents.
    As India looks ahead, they will need to regroup quickly, analyze their mistakes, and work on their weaknesses. This abrupt dip in form serves as a stark reminder of the unpredictable nature of cricket and the need for consistent performance at the international level. It remains to be seen how the team bounces back from this setback and whether they can regain their winning momentum
